Jannik Sinner's Doha debut shines as he outmaneuvers Alexei Popyrin to secure a spot in the Qatar ExxonMobil Open's quarter-finals. The Italian's performance is a testament to his resilience, as he withstood Popyrin's powerful serves and aggressive play to emerge victorious. This win extends Sinner's impressive streak of 50 consecutive victories against players outside the Top 50 in the PIF ATP Rankings, a remarkable achievement in the tennis world. But here's the intriguing part: Sinner's respect for his opponents remains unwavering, as he emphasizes the importance of maintaining focus and playing at the highest level, regardless of rankings. Popyrin, a confident player, showcased his skills with 16 winners, but Sinner's composure proved decisive. The Italian's journey continues as he aims for his third consecutive ATP 500 title, with a potential showdown against World No. 1 Carlos Alcaraz on the horizon, marking the 17th chapter of their rivalry. Before that, Sinner must navigate a challenging last-eight match against sixth seed and 2024 finalist Jakub Mensik, who advanced with a dominant performance. The tournament also features Jiri Lehecka and Arthur Fils, both advancing to the quarter-finals, setting up an exciting clash between them. Fils, working with the legendary Goran Ivanisevic, is making a strong comeback after an injury, tied 1-1 with Jiri Lehecka in their head-to-head series.
